The characters are rendered as quads with two triangles using indexed geometry. There are two main classes under src
, Atlas and Text2D. The
class Atlas creates a texture atlas and holds the information of each one of the characters (width, height, x/y displacement, etc). Text2D uses the
atlas information to create the vertex, index and texture buffers. Under the folder example
there's and example of how to use these classes.
You can render as many strings as you want with a single drawing call. Each Text2D instance can hold different strings of different sizes and positions. We can also have differently colored strings within the same object. We can't have differently colored words in the same string, maybe some day I will implement that.

FreeType is necessary to create the atlas, but theoretically you could drop it from your OpenGL code if you create a separate application to save the atlas as an image and the character data in some sort of file, and then load them in your OpenGL application.
